A degree in child care & support services management is more popular than many other degrees. In fact, it ranks #283 out of 1506 on popularity of all such degrees in the nation. This means you won't have too much trouble finding schools that offer the degree.

In 2024, College Factual analyzed 4 schools in order to identify the top ones for its Best Child Care & Support Services Management Schools in the New England Region ranking. When you put them all together, these colleges and universities awarded 279 degrees in child care & support services management during the 2020-2021 academic year.

Massasoit Community College is a wonderful choice for students interested in a degree in child care & support services management. Located in the large suburb of Brockton, Massasoit Community College is a public college with a small student population. This college ranks 57th out of 63 schools for overall quality in the state of Massachusetts.

There were roughly 6 child care & support services management students who graduated with this degree at Massasoit Community College in the most recent year we have data available.

Every student pursuing a degree in child care & support services management needs to look into Framingham State University. Framingham State is a small public university located in the city of Framingham. A Best Colleges rank of #812 out of 2,217 colleges nationwide means Framingham State is a great university overall.

There were approximately 17 child care & support services management students who graduated with this degree at Framingham State in the most recent data year.

Post University is one of the finest schools in the United States for getting a degree in child care & support services management. Post University is a large private for-profit university located in the medium-sized suburb of Waterbury. A Best Colleges rank of #1024 out of 2,217 colleges nationwide means Post University is a great university overall.

There were roughly 165 child care & support services management students who graduated with this degree at Post University in the most recent data year.

It is hard to beat Holyoke Community College if you want to pursue a degree in child care & support services management. Located in the suburb of Holyoke, Holyoke Community College is a public college with a small student population. This college ranks 62nd out of 63 schools for overall quality in the state of Massachusetts.

There were about 18 child care & support services management students who graduated with this degree at Holyoke Community College in the most recent year we have data available.
